Abstract

The invention provides methods which can be used to structure even precious metal electrodes with conventional CMP steps, in particular with the aid of conventional slurries such as are already used to structure non-precious metals. Owing to the formation of an alloy, the chemically active components of the slurry are capable of attacking the additive to the precious metal in the alloy, as a result of which the surface of the alloy layer is roughened and the mechanical removal of the precious metal is increased.
